The CS42426-CQZ operates by converting analog audio signals into digital format using a high-resolution ADC (Analog-to-Digital Converter). It also performs the reverse process, converting digital audio signals back into analog format using a high-quality DAC (Digital-to-Analog Converter). The integrated circuit utilizes advanced signal processing techniques to ensure accurate and faithful audio reproduction.
